Common Curiosities About 5 Ways To Keep Your Luscious Locks While Nursing Your Little Miracle
Will My Hair Grow Back After Pregnancy?
The answer is yes. Hair growth after pregnancy is a natural process that can take several months to a year or more. Factors such as genetics, diet, and overall health play a significant role in determining hair growth patterns.
Can I Use Normal Shampoo During Pregnancy and Lactation?
While it may be tempting to continue using your regular shampoo, it’s essential to switch to a gentle, sulfate-free option during pregnancy and lactation. Sulfates can strip the hair of its natural oils, leading to dryness, breakage, and irritation.
How Often Should I Wash My Hair During Pregnancy and Lactation?
It’s generally recommended to wash your hair 2-3 times a week during pregnancy and lactation. Over-washing can strip the hair of its natural oils, leading to dryness and breakage.
Myths and Misconceptions About 5 Ways To Keep Your Luscious Locks While Nursing Your Little Miracle
One common myth is that using coconut oil will stimulate hair growth. While coconut oil does have moisturizing properties, its ability to stimulate hair growth is largely anecdotal and unproven.
Another misconception is that hair loss during pregnancy and lactation is a sign of poor nutrition. While nutrition plays a crucial role in hair growth, hair loss can also be caused by hormonal changes, stress, and other factors.
